A large conjugated rigid dimer acceptor enables 20.19% efficiency in organic solar cells
Wendi Shi, Qiansai Han, Wenkai Zhao, Ruohan Wang, Longyu Li, Guangkun Song, Xin Chen, Guankui Long, Zhaoyang Yao, Yan Lu, Chenxi Li, Xiangjian Wan, Yongsheng Chen
Abstract
A dimer acceptor QD-1 with a large conjugated rigid skeleton is reported, showing low disorder, weak electro-photon coupling, and thus low non-radiative recombination loss. An efficiency of 20.19% is achieved for the QD-1-based ternary device.
